SAP ABAP IMG Activity SIMG_ORKAKOCM (Replace Classification With User-Defined Fields)
Hierarchy
BBPCRM (Software Component) BBPCRM
   CRM (Application Component) Customer Relationship Management
     CRM_APPLICATION (Package) All CRM Components Without Special Structure Packages
       KAUC (Package) Customizing R/3 Cost Accounting, Orders
IMG Activity
ID SIMG_ORKAKOCM Replace Classification With User-Defined Fields  
Transaction Code S_ALR_87005156   IMG Activity: SIMG_ORKAKOCM 
Created on 19981222    
Customizing Attributes SIMG_ORKAKOCM   Replace Classification With User-Defined Fields 
Customizing Activity SIMG_ORKAKOCM   Replace Classification With User-Defined Fields 
Document
Document Class SIMG   Hypertext: Object Class - Class to which a document belongs.
Document Name SIMG_ORKAKOCM    

If you wish to use internal order summarization, you should input user-defined fields in the order master data to replace classification. Classification for internal orders is no longer being developed.

In this IMG activity, you transfer the characteristic values of an internal order from classification to the user-defined fields in the master data. You can use this transfer for internal orders (order types from category 01, 02 and 03) for which classification is active.

All of the free characteristics in a field in the CI_AUFK structure (part of the AUFK order table) are displayed during this transfer. To create user-defined fields in CI_AUFK, use the COOPA003 enhancement.

Comparison: Classification - User-Defined Fields

When you decide whether and when to convert your classification data, you should note the following:

  • Order summarization can be executed using user-defined fields in the order master data. Summarization using classification is not being developed any longer, and will not be supported in a later release. If you wish to use the order summary on a long term basis, you need to convert your classification data.
  • User-defined fields in the order master data have the same function scope as normal master data fields. (For further information see the COOPA003 enhancement documentation.) Classification characteristics have a significantly smaller function scope.
  • Processing classification data is not as stable as processing data from user-defined fields.
  • Classification has a poorer performance.
  • To select orders, you can go into classification and create characteristics with "abstract data types" and characteristics with more than one attribute. You cannot do this with user-defined fields in the order master. This type of field cannot be used for summarization.
  • Development and testing of the COOPA003 enhancement and the conversion of classification data in user-defined fields can only be carried out with programming expertise. Depending upon the complexitiy, it can take several days.

Therefore, in the following cases only, do not convert your classification data:

  • If you are not using your order summarization, and
  • The classification function scope is sufficient for your purposes, and
  • The conversion expense is not worth it for your purposes.

For further information, see:

  • COOPA003 enhancement documentation
  • KKRF 0002 enhancement documentation

Actions

  1. Identify which characteristics you need for order classification. Decide which of these characteristics you wish to transfer to the order master data.
  2. Develop and activate the COOPA003 enhancement. To do this, choose the "Develop Enhancements for Order Master Data " step. For further information, see "Important notes on the definition of field formats of user-defined fields in the CI_AUFK".

    You can use the KKRF0002 enhancement, should the functions of the conversion report not suffice and you wish to structure the conversion of the characteristic attributes yourself. This makes all the characteristic attributes of the order available. You can display these in any way you wish on the CI_AUFK fields, without any kind of naming convention or formatting requirements. You can also evaluate the UDEF or ADT formats as well as several attributes for a characteristic. Likewise, you can split characteristics into several fields, group several characteristics into one field or make other format changes.

    To develop the KKRF0002 enhancement, choose the "Develop enhancements for order master data" step.

  3. Carry out a test conversion.
    1. Create a new order type and classify some orders.
    2. Choose "Convert classification data in user-defined fields". To do this, you need authorization to change orders.
    3. Choose "Maintain Assignments". This enables you to specify which characteristics should be transferred to which fields in the RKOCLMIG table, according to client.
    4. If the table does not yet have any entries, the system transfers the characteristic names as default values. Fill out the corresponding fieldnames. You do not need to enter a field name for characteristics, which you do not wish to transfer. The characteristic is thus disregarded.
      Example:
      You defined a free characteristic with the characteristic name "ABCD", and you transferred it to the SAP_KKR_CLASS class. You wish to transfer the field content to the "ZZEFGH" field. To do this, you transfer an "ABCD" "ZZEFGH" entry.
    5. Enter an order type and restrict the processing to order number entry, if required.
    6. Execute the conversion. You must not lock orders for online processing, as this terminates the program.
    7. The system ignores locked orders during background processing, and lists them in a log.

If the conversion was successfully completed, your user-defined fields in AUFK are now filled. If this is the case, do the following:

  1. Execute conversion for your productive orders in each relevant client.
    1. To improve performance, have the system perform conversion in the background and do not convert all the order types at the same time.
    2. Test to see whether your user-defined fields are correctly filled in the AUFK.
    3. The conversion report does not delete the classification data. Therefore, you can use the old and the new summarization in parallel, whereby the system does not execute an automatic data adjustment.
      You can start the conversion more than once, and the system overwrites the data in the CI_AUFK table each time.
    4. Classification data can use up a significant amount of database capacity. If you no longer require this data, undo the "Classifcation" indicator in the order type and confirm that you wish to delete the classification data.

Business Attributes
ASAP Roadmap ID 257   Create User Exits 
Mandatory / Optional 2   Optional activity 
Critical / Non-Critical 2   Non-critical 
Country-Dependency A   Valid for all countries 
Assigned Application Components
Documentation Object Class Documentation Object Name Current line number Application Component Application Component Name
SIMG SIMG_ORKAKOCM 0 HLA0001399 Master Data 
Maintenance Objects
Maintenance object type C   Customizing Object 
Assigned objects
Customizing Object Object Type Transaction Code Sub-object Do not Summarize Skip Subset Dialog Box Description for multiple selections
IMGDUMMY D - Dummy object KOCM OPA-UMSK Conversion Classification -> User-Defined Fields in AUFK 
History
Last changed by/on SAP  19981222 
SAP Release Created in